Back-to-back second win for Salem Spartans (SS) in the ongoing Tamil Nadu Premier League (TNPL 2025). In match 9 of the tournament, they got the better hand over Idream Tiruppur Tamizhans (ITT) by 4 wickets in hand and 1 ball to spare. The match was a close encounter and concluded in the very last over of the contest. All-round Harish Kumar's unbeaten innings in the end proved decisive to find the winner of the night. Before the next match, ITT will have to push extra effort during their practice sessions to mobilize their fielding more.
After winning the toss, SS chose to bowl first at Salem Cricket Foundation Stadium. The opening pair of Tiruppur stitched a 73-run partnership to build a solid foundation, though they did not utilize it well due to some tight bowling performances by the home team. Apart from their opening stand, the rest of their batting remained underwhelming, and the team ended with 177/8 on the scorecard. M. Poiyamozhi took 3, and M. Mohammed claimed 2 scalps with smart economy rates.
Salem lost their first wicket at 0 on the scoreboard and lost both of their opponents when the team was at 27. From there they fought back and grabbed the second win on the trot. Nidish Rajagopal's 64 and R. Kavin's 32 in the middle overs change the whole complexion of the match. Harish and Boopathi Vaishna Kumar did the rest of the business properly for Spartans.

iDream Tiruppur Tamizhans- 177/8 (20)
Batsman | Runs / Balls | Bowlers | Wickets/ Overs |
Tushar Raheja | 74 (28) | M Poiyamozhi | 3/29 (4 Overs) |
Pradosh Ranjan Paul | 25 (22) | M. Mohammed | 2/27 (4 Overs) |
Amith Sathvik | 25 (28) | C Hari Nishaanth | 1/11 (1 Overs) |
Salem Spartans - 178/6 (19.5)
Batsman | Runs / Balls | Bowlers | Wickets/ Overs |
Nidish Rajagopal | 69 (44) | R Silambarasan | 2/26 (4 Overs) |
R Kavin | 32 (26) | T. Natarajan | 2/28 (3.5 Overs) |
Harish Kumar | 23* (12) | Sai Kishore | 1/27 (4 Overs) |
